Calotropis Gigantea is a robust perennial shrub or small tree known for its fragrant flowers that attract butterflies and bees. This hardy plant is ideal for outdoor gardens and landscapes, providing both aesthetic appeal and ecological benefits. It thrives in sunny locations and can tolerate a range of soil types, making it easy to grow and maintain.
Features and Specifications:
-
Plant Type: Perennial shrub or small tree
-
Variety: Calotropis Gigantea (Giant Milkweed/Crown Flower)
-
Growth Habit: Upright, branching, and bushy
-
Maturity: Flowers in 2–3 years from sowing
-
Growing Season: Spring to early fall
-
USDA Hardiness Zones: 9–11
-
Sowing Months:
-
Zones 9–11: February–June
-
-
Light Requirements: Full sun
-
Soil Requirements: Well-drained soil; tolerant to poor, sandy, or rocky soils
-
Watering: Low to moderate; drought-tolerant once established
-
Uses: Ornamental garden, attracting pollinators, landscape enhancement
-
Special Features: Fragrant flowers that attract butterflies and bees; hardy and low-maintenance
